#0d3622 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0d3622 is composed of 5.1% red, 21.2%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 37% yellow and 78.8% black. It has a hue angle of 150.7 degrees, a saturation of 61.2% and a lightness of 13.1%. #0d3622 color hex could be obtained by blending #1a6c44 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#0d3622 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#0d3622 has RGB values of R:13, G:54,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.79. Its decimal value is 865826.

Hex triplet 0d3622 #0d3622
RGB Decimal 13, 54, 34 rgb(13,54,34)
RGB Percent 5.1, 21.2, 13.3 rgb(5.1%,21.2%,13.3%)
CMYK 76, 0, 37, 79
HSL 150.7°, 61.2, 13.1 hsl(150.7,61.2%,13.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 150.7°, 75.9, 21.2
Web Safe 003333 #003333
CIE-LAB 19.388, -19.912, 8.529
XYZ 1.774, 2.839, 1.968
xyY 0.27, 0.431, 2.839
CIE-LCH 19.388, 21.661, 156.813
CIE-LUV 19.388, -14.289, 10.088
Hunter-Lab 16.85, -10.697, 4.871
Binary 00001101, 00110110, 00100010

Shades and Tints of #0d3622

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020704 is the darkest color, while #f6fd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0d3622

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1f2422 is the less saturated color, while #004322 is the most saturated one.
